+ -
当前位置:首页 → 问答吧 → FastReport 脚本要打开两次!

FastReport 脚本要打开两次!

时间:2011-10-22

来源:互联网

我在FastReport的OnStartReport中写入:

  if <frxDBDataset1."xm">='中国人' then
  begin
  Memo1.text:=<frxDBDataset3."Dh">;
  end;


  我第一遍预览的时候,没执行到,第二遍预览才可以正常执行~!也就是说,预览的总是上次报表的数据!


例:第一次打开的时候XM字段是“中国人”,而预览没效果。关闭后再次预览就有了。也就是说预览的总是N次减1的数据!必须同一个数据,预览两次才能达到效果~!


这个办法怎么解决??

作者: zhan1616   发布时间: 2011-10-22

发现问题了~!

问题出在:
for I:= 0 to <Line>-1 do

问题是<Line>总是N次打开减1的数据!


不知道如何实时更新这个<Line>

作者: zhan1616   发布时间: 2011-10-22